Output 64959c1a47305963b0ea35785c9d7dd8c221ad58376a19b889c4beb9d9568c90:0

value
560528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b9189442299d15f5a187223dce2f7f482037b7 OP_EQUAL
address
3HSHtEaj3xMKqWfq5VR3e7bvXDYjBbpE91
transaction
64959c1a47305963b0ea35785c9d7dd8c221ad58376a19b889c4beb9d9568c90
spent
true